EXPLANATIONS OP TERMS USED AND RULES FOLLOWED IN COMPILING RECORDS. Q. C. is an abbreviation for Quit Claim deed, 1. e., a deed wherein all the right, title and interest ot the grantor is con¬ veyed, omitting ali covenants and war¬ ranty. C. a G. means a deed containing Cove¬ nant against Grantor only, in which he covenants that he hath not done any act whereby the estate conveyed may be im¬ peached, charged or encumbered. B. & S. is an abbreviation for Bargain and Sale deed, wherein, although the seller makes no expressed consideration, he really grants or conveys the property for a valuable consideration, and thus im¬ pliedly claims to be the owner of it. The street and avenue numbers given in these lists are, in all cases, taken from the Insurance maps when they are not mentioned in the deeds. The numbers, it will occasionally be found, do not cor¬ respond with the existing ones, owing to there having been no official designation made of them by the Department of Pub¬ lic Works. The flrst date is the date the deed was drawn. The second date is the date ot (lling same. When both dates are the same, only one is given. When the date ot drawing is other than in the current year the stated year is given. When both the dates are in the same year the year follows the second date. The figures in each conveyance, thus, 2:482-10, denote that the property men¬ tioned is in section 2, block 482. lot 10. It should also be noted in section and block numbers that the instrument as flled Is strictly followed. A $20.000—$30,000 indicates the as¬ sessed value ot the property, the flrst flgures being for the lot only and the second flgures representing both lot and building. Letter P b^efore second figure indicates that the property Is assessed as In course of construction. Valuations ar© from tho assessment roll ot 1915. 'I', t^. n'-ec»dlnsr tbe consideration In a conveyance means that the deed or con¬ veyance has been recorded under the Tor¬ ren System. Plats and apartment houses are classi¬ fied as tenements. Residences as dwellings. All Christian names, streets, avenues, states and months are abbreviated when possible, also in some instances names of Banks, Trusts and Insurance Companies. The number in ( ) preceding the serial number to the right of the date line, at head of this page is the Index number for the Checking Index. The Star following names of street or avenue in the Bronx Conveyances, Leases and Mortgages indicates that the prop¬ erty recorded is in the annexed district, tor which there Is no section or block number.
